Green a magical colour to photograph.

 

The colour green is considered a cooler colour

On the spectrum it is a combination of blue and yellow in varying degrees.

I would have to say this is not a colour many photographers will gravitate towards and yet God made green fields and hills so vast that they can dominate and be a strong and presiding force in our earth. Conservationists love the word green!! If you eat green, live green, then surely you can activate the universe on your behalf, green is the new black!!

Green has a calming effect most possibly because humans do associate it with nature and the countryside, therefore the feelings of stillness, peace, tranquility and health seem to reign.

Many times green will overpower and almost add a harsh effect to an image. Again it’s your preference but I suggest adding a more blue tone and desaturating ever so slightly. This takes out any orange/yellow hues in the green. This is what I have done for my images below.

Green is generally not soft and kind to the eyes like pink or light blue…… but it will add a vivid and calming effect and is still a great colour to work with.

Some photographers have managed to make green a most beautiful and satisfying colour. Hilde Mork in my opinion has nailed the colour green perfectly. You may have to browse extensively through her Instagram account to find her greenish images. I notice she uses green in a very subtle way and her images seem to make green look soft, beautiful and peaceful.
